基于射流振荡式流量测量的热量表设计

【摘要】 热量表是用于供热系统热消耗量计量的仪表。随着政策的进一步明朗,作为供热体制改革和建筑节能中必不可少的关键工具、分户计量供热系统的核心设备,其市场需求必将会越来越大。热量表技术中最关键的是流量的测量。供热系统中做为传热介质的水流量小、温度高,并且在国内还存在着供热水质差,铁屑、杂质多等问题,这些都大大地影响了常用流量测量手段在热量表中的应用效果,另外,国内市场的特点又决定了热量表所采用的流量测量方案必须是低成本的,包括生产成本与维护成本。在这样的背景下,本文首先对热量表领域的相关问题进行了综述,然后探讨了低功耗、智能化热量表的总体结构问题,并就热量表中射流式流量测量、温度测量、热量积分和通信管理等几个模块的设计进行了详细的分析。本文的主要贡献如下:1.分析了热量表流量测量的特殊要求和射流振荡式流量测量的特点,论证了射流流量计在热量表应用中的可行性。2.用CFD工具仿真了附壁式射流振荡腔内的非定常流场动态特性,针对不同的检测方法给出了传感器最佳安放位置的仿真结果,并对射流腔进行了初步的实验测试验证。3.设计了适合热量表高温差精度要求的温度测量方案,并给出了基于MSP430的低功耗热量表设计。

【Abstract】 Heat meter is a tool for heat consumption measurement in heating systems.As aimportant role in the reform process of domestic heat supply system, it definitelyowns a considerable emerging market.Flowrate metering is the most critical part in heat meter technology.The waterflowing in heating systems is hot and in small-flowrate status.There are much moreproblems with domestic systems,such as poor water quality and iron impurities.Allof these with the demestic market’s low-cost requirement have greatly affected theflow measurement instruments used in the heat meter application.Based on such background, this paper first reviewed heat meter related issues,then explored the overall structure of heat meter, and in succession, made detailedanalyses of module design,including modules such as flowrate measurement,temperature measurement, heat integration and communication management.The main contributions of this paper are as follows:1. The feasibility of employing the fluidic flowmeter in heat meter system isdemonstrated based on the analysis of fluidic oscillation and heat meter’sspecial requirements in flowrate metering.2. Unsteady simulation analysis of fluidic oscillation in FLUENT is carriedon. Based on the simulation, optimal placements of different type of sensorsare proposed.Finally, experimental verification result is analyzed.3. A temperature measurement program is proposed,which is specilized formeeting the requirement of high accuracy in temperature differencemeasurement,and a low-power design of heat meter based on MSP430 isgiven.
